]> git.ipfire.org Git - thirdparty/freeradius-server.git/commitdiff
Simplify regex.
authorAlan T. DeKok <aland@freeradius.org>
Thu, 31 Dec 2015 00:31:02 +0000 (19:31 -0500)
committerAlan T. DeKok <aland@freeradius.org>
Thu, 31 Dec 2015 00:53:42 +0000 (19:53 -0500)
raddb/policy.d/filter

index 134d2f7a10a0528f6db8cd7803438554c248fb71..080b4ff6139a6b9ad6702be7f4109ad8dba2e5ef 100644 (file)
@@ -42,7 +42,7 @@ filter_username {
        #  reject Multiple @'s
        #  e.g. "user@site.com@site.com"
        #
-       if (&User-Name =~ /@.*@/ ) {
+       if (&User-Name =~ /@[^@]*@/ ) {
                update reply {
                        &Reply-Message += 'Rejected: Multiple @ in username'
                }